A new sensational version of our political and military history, destroying the usual ideas and myths about the driving forces and causes of key events in the mid-twentieth century. Putting the well-known and little-known facts and events of those years into a single mosaic, the author talks about the true causes of the Berlin and Caribbean crises, which official propaganda, politicians and historians in Russia and abroad are silent about. These events were the culmination of the second half of the 20th century, a turning point and predetermined the historical fate of the Soviet Union and communist ideology, the subsequent collapse of the USSR and the triumph of capitalist economies and the free market.
This is a book about how the leadership of the USSR, headed by Nikita Khrushchev, trying to preserve the "cause of Lenin", tried to achieve what Stalin had in mind, but could not achieve during the Second World War - to fan the fire of the World Revolution and, under the guise of communist ideology, achieve world domination. This is a book about political intrigues and struggle for power, about the confrontation between two superpowers and their secret services, about covert intelligence operations and about people who pushed humanity to destruction and saved it.
The book contains more than 150 photographs, including including unique archival photographs published in Russia for the first time.
80 inserts with illustrations.
